Author: jsrain Date: Thu Oct 7 09:04:35 2010 New Revision: 62557 URL: http://svn.opensuse.org/viewcvs/yast?rev=62557&view=rev Log: updated workflow Modified: branches/tmp/jsrain/unattended-migration/installation/control/control.SLED.xml branches/tmp/jsrain/unattended-migration/installation/control/control.SLES.xml Modified: branches/tmp/jsrain/unattended-migration/installation/control/control.SLED.xml URL: http://svn.opensuse.org/viewcvs/yast/branches/tmp/jsrain/unattended-migration/installation/control/control.SLED.xml?rev=62557&r1=62556&r2=62557&view=diff ============================================================================== --- branches/tmp/jsrain/unattended-migration/installation/control/control.SLED.xml (original) +++ branches/tmp/jsrain/unattended-migration/installation/control/control.SLED.xml Thu Oct 7 09:04:35 2010 @@ -467,7 +467,7 @@ <proposal> <label>Installation Settings</label> - <mode>update</mode> + <mode>update,autoupgrade</mode> <stage>initial</stage> <name>initial</name> <enable_skip>no</enable_skip> @@ -746,6 +746,7 @@ </modules> </workflow> + <!-- assures that the same list of steps is shown in 2nd stage where no special mode exists --> <workflow> <defaults> <archs>all</archs> @@ -754,111 +755,26 @@ <mode>update</mode> <stage>initial</stage> <modules config:type="list"> - <module> - <name>complex_welcome</name> - <label>Welcome</label> - <enable_back>no</enable_back> - <enable_next>yes</enable_next> - <arguments> - <first_run>yes</first_run> - </arguments> - <retranslate config:type="boolean">true</retranslate> - </module> - <module> - <label>Welcome</label> - <name>checkmedia</name>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> - </module> - <module> - <label>Disk Activation</label> - <name>disks_activate</name>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> - </module> - <module> - <label>System Analysis</label> - <name>system_analysis</name>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> - </module> - <module> - <label>System Analysis</label> - <name>mode</name>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> - </module> - <module> - <label>System for Update</label> - <name>update_partition</name>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> + <module> + <label>AutoYaST Settings</label> + <name>autosetup_upgrade</name> </module> <module> - <name>upgrade_urls</name> - <enable_back>yes</enable_back> - </module> - <module> - <label>Add-On Products</label> - <name>add-on</name>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> - </module> - <module> <heading>yes</heading> <label>Update</label> </module> <module> - <label>Update Summary</label> - <name>lilo_convert</name> - <execute>inst_lilo_convert</execute> - </module> - <module> - <label>Update Summary</label> - <name>inital_update_proposal</name> + <label>AutoYaST Settings</label> + <name>initial_update_proposal</name> <execute>inst_proposal</execute> <proposal>initial</proposal> - </module> - <!-- - BNC #414490, #477778: Updating SLES 10 (hdX) to SLES 11 (sdX) - produces multiple identical grub boot menu entries - --> - <module> - <label>Perform Update</label> - <name>bl_preupdate</name> - <execute>bootloader_preupdate</execute> - </module> - <!-- - FATE #303860: Provide consistent progress during installation - BNC #438848: Also during upgrade - --> - <module> - <label>Perform Update</label> - <name>prepareprogress</name> - </module> - - <module> - <label>Perform Update</label> - <name>do_resize</name> - <update config:type="boolean">false</update> - <archs>i386,x86_64,ia64</archs> - </module> - <module> - <label>Perform Update</label> - <name>prepdisk</name> - </module> - <module> - <label>Perform Update</label> - <name>kickoff</name> + <enable_back>no</enable_back> + <enable_next>yes</enable_next> </module> <module> <label>Perform Update</label> <name>rpmcopy</name> </module> - <module> - <label>Perform Update</label> - <name>finish</name> - </module> </modules> </workflow> @@ -1281,6 +1197,142 @@ <workflow> <defaults> <archs>all</archs> + </defaults> + <label>Preparation</label> + <mode>autoupgrade</mode> + <stage>initial</stage> + <modules config:type="list"> +<!-- + <module> + <label>Disk Activation</label> + <name>disks_activate</name> + <enable_back>yes</enable_back> + <enable_next>yes</enable_next> + </module> +--> + <module> + <label>System Analysis</label> + <name>system_analysis</name> + <enable_back>yes</enable_back> + <enable_next>yes</enable_next> + </module> + <module> + <label>System for Update</label> + <name>update_partition_auto</name> + <enable_back>yes</enable_back> + <enable_next>yes</enable_next> + </module> + <module> + <label>AutoYaST Settings</label> + <name>autoinit</name> + <archs>all</archs> + <retranslate config:type="boolean">true</retranslate> + </module> + <module> + <label>AutoYaST Settings</label> + <name>autosetup_upgrade</name> + </module> +<!-- + <module> + <name>upgrade_urls</name> + <enable_back>yes</enable_back> + </module> +--> +<!-- + <module> + <label>Add-On Products</label> + <name>add-on</name> + <enable_back>yes</enable_back> + <enable_next>yes</enable_next> + </module> +--> + <module> + <heading>yes</heading> + <label>Update</label> + </module> +<!-- + <module> + <label>AutoYaST Settings</label> + <name>autosetup</name> + </module> +--> +<!-- + <module> + <label>Update Summary</label> + <name>lilo_convert</name> + <execute>inst_lilo_convert</execute> + </module> +--> + <module> + <label>AutoYaST Settings</label> + <name>initial_update_proposal</name> + <execute>inst_proposal</execute> + <proposal>initial</proposal> + <enable_back>no</enable_back> + <enable_next>yes</enable_next> + </module> +<!-- + <module> + <label>AutoYaST Settings</label> + <name>neco_co_urcite_neexistuje</name> + </module> +--> + <!-- + BNC #414490, #477778: Updating SLES 10 (hdX) to SLES 11 (sdX) + produces multiple identical grub boot menu entries + --> + <module> + <label>Perform Update</label> + <name>bl_preupdate</name> + <execute>bootloader_preupdate</execute> + </module> + <!-- + FATE #303860: Provide consistent progress during installation + BNC #438848: Also during upgrade + --> + <module> + <label>Perform Update</label> + <name>prepareprogress</name> + </module> + + <module> + <label>Perform Update</label> + <name>do_resize</name> + <update config:type="boolean">false</update> + <archs>i386,x86_64,ia64</archs> + </module> + <module> + <label>Perform Update</label> + <name>prepdisk</name> + </module> + <module> + <label>Perform Update</label> + <name>kickoff</name> + </module> + <module> + <label>Perform Update</label> + <name>store_upgrade_software</name> + </module> + <module> + <label>Perform Update</label> + <name>rpmcopy</name> + </module> + <module> + <!-- FATE #304940: s390 reIPL --> + <label>Perform Update</label> + <name>reiplauto</name> + <archs>s390</archs> + </module> + <module> + <label>Perform Update</label> + <name>finish</name> + </module> + </modules> + </workflow> + + <workflow> + <defaults> + <archs>all</archs> <enable_back>no</enable_back> <enable_next>no</enable_next> </defaults> @@ -1312,6 +1364,72 @@ </module> </modules> </workflow> + + <!-- dummy, but needed to trigger 2nd stage --> + <workflow> + <defaults> + <archs>all</archs> + <enable_back>no</enable_back> + <enable_next>no</enable_next> + </defaults> + <stage>continue</stage> + <mode>autoupgrade</mode> + <modules config:type="list"> + <module> + <label>Perform Update</label> + <name>autopost</name> + </module> + <module> + <label>Perform Update</label> + <name>rpmcopy_secondstage</name> + </module> + <module> + <heading>yes</heading> + <label>Configuration</label> + </module> + <module> + <label>System Configuration</label> + <name>autoconfigure</name> + </module> + <module> + <label>Clean Up</label> + <name>suseconfig</name> + </module> + </modules> + </workflow> + + <!-- is for AutoUpdate, special mode does not exist - for SP1, so that 2nd stage YaST needn't be modified --> + <workflow> + <defaults> + <archs>all</archs> + <enable_back>no</enable_back> + <enable_next>no</enable_next> + </defaults> + <stage>continue</stage> + <mode>update</mode> + <modules config:type="list"> + <module> + <label>Perform Update</label> + <name>autopost</name> + </module> + <module> + <label>Perform Update</label> + <name>rpmcopy_secondstage</name> + </module> + <module> + <heading>yes</heading> + <label>Configuration</label> + </module> + <module> + <label>System Configuration</label> + <name>autoconfigure</name> + </module> + <module> + <label>Clean Up</label> + <name>suseconfig</name> + </module> + </modules> + </workflow> </workflows> </productDefines> Modified: branches/tmp/jsrain/unattended-migration/installation/control/control.SLES.xml URL: http://svn.opensuse.org/viewcvs/yast/branches/tmp/jsrain/unattended-migration/installation/control/control.SLES.xml?rev=62557&r1=62556&r2=62557&view=diff ============================================================================== --- branches/tmp/jsrain/unattended-migration/installation/control/control.SLES.xml (original) +++ branches/tmp/jsrain/unattended-migration/installation/control/control.SLES.xml Thu Oct 7 09:04:35 2010 @@ -886,6 +886,7 @@ </modules> </workflow> + <!-- assures that the same list of steps is shown in 2nd stage where no special mode exists --> <workflow> <defaults> <archs>all</archs> @@ -894,117 +895,26 @@ <mode>update</mode> <stage>initial</stage> <modules config:type="list"> - <module> - <name>complex_welcome</name> - <label>Welcome</label> - <enable_back>no</enable_back> - <enable_next>yes</enable_next> - <arguments> - <first_run>yes</first_run> - </arguments> - <retranslate config:type="boolean">true</retranslate> - </module> - <module> - <label>Welcome</label> - <name>checkmedia</name>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> - </module> - <module> - <label>Disk Activation</label> - <name>disks_activate</name>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> - </module> - <module> - <label>System Analysis</label> - <name>system_analysis</name>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> - </module> - <module> - <label>System Analysis</label> - <name>mode</name>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> - </module> - <module> - <label>System for Update</label> - <name>update_partition</name>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> + <module> + <label>AutoYaST Settings</label> + <name>autosetup_upgrade</name> </module> <module> - <name>upgrade_urls</name> - <enable_back>yes</enable_back> - </module> - <module> - <label>Add-On Products</label> - <name>add-on</name>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> - </module> - <module> <heading>yes</heading> <label>Update</label> </module> <module> - <label>Update Summary</label> - <name>lilo_convert</name> - <execute>inst_lilo_convert</execute> - </module> - <module> - <label>Update Summary</label> + <label>AutoYaST Settings</label> <name>initial_update_proposal</name> <execute>inst_proposal</execute> <proposal>initial</proposal> - </module> - <!-- - BNC #414490, #477778: Updating SLES 10 (hdX) to SLES 11 (sdX) - produces multiple identical grub boot menu entries - --> - <module> - <label>Perform Update</label> - <name>bl_preupdate</name> - <execute>bootloader_preupdate</execute> - </module> - <!-- - FATE #303860: Provide consistent progress during installation - BNC #438848: Also during upgrade - --> - <module> - <label>Perform Update</label> - <name>prepareprogress</name> - </module> - - <module> - <label>Perform Update</label> - <name>do_resize</name> - <update config:type="boolean">false</update> - <archs>i386,x86_64,ia64</archs> - </module> - <module> - <label>Perform Update</label> - <name>prepdisk</name> - </module> - <module> - <label>Perform Update</label> - <name>kickoff</name> + <enable_back>no</enable_back> + <enable_next>yes</enable_next> </module> <module> <label>Perform Update</label> <name>rpmcopy</name> </module> - <module> - <!-- FATE #304940: s390 reIPL --> - <label>Perform Update</label> - <name>reiplauto</name> - <archs>s390</archs> - </module> - <module> - <label>Perform Update</label> - <name>finish</name> - </module> </modules> </workflow> @@ -1123,103 +1033,6 @@ <workflow> <stage>continue</stage> - <mode>update</mode> - <defaults> - <archs>all</archs> - <enable_back>no</enable_back> - <enable_next>no</enable_next> - </defaults> - <modules config:type="list"> - <module> - <label>Perform Update</label> - <name>rpmcopy_secondstage</name> - </module> - <module> - <heading>yes</heading> - <label>Configuration</label> - </module> - <module> - <label>Network</label> - <name>ask_net_test</name> - <!-- The very first interactive dialog --> - <enable_back>no</enable_back> - <enable_next>yes</enable_next> - </module> - <module> - <label>Network</label> - <name>do_net_test</name>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> - </module> - <module> - <label>Customer Center</label> - <name>addon_update_sources</name> - </module> - <module> - <label>Customer Center</label> - <name>suse_register</name>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> - </module> - <module> - <label>Online Update</label> - <name>ask_online_update</name>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> - </module> - <module> - <label>Online Update</label> - <name>you</name>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> - </module> - <module> - <label>Online Update</label> - <name>restore_settings</name> - </module> - <module> - <label>Clean Up</label> - <name>suseconfig</name> - </module> - <module> - <label>Release Notes</label> - <name>release_notes</name>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> - </module> - - <!-- FATE #302495: New possibility to stop and disable ZMD --> - <module> - <!-- 'name' is used as ID only, see 'execute' --> - <name>congratulate_all_archs</name> - <execute>inst_congratulate</execute> - <archs>i386,x86_64,ia64,ppc,ppc64</archs> - <arguments> - <show_zmd_turnoff_checkbox>yes</show_zmd_turnoff_checkbox> - <zmd_turnoff_default_state>no</zmd_turnoff_default_state> - </arguments>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> - </module> - <!-- S/390 and S/390x pre-selected by default --> - <module> - <!-- 'name' is used as ID only, see 'execute' --> - <name>congratulate_s390_archs</name> - <execute>inst_congratulate</execute> - <archs>s390,s390x</archs> - <arguments> - <show_zmd_turnoff_checkbox>yes</show_zmd_turnoff_checkbox> - <zmd_turnoff_default_state>yes</zmd_turnoff_default_state> - </arguments> - <enable_back>yes</enable_back> - <enable_next>yes</enable_next> - </module> - - </modules> - </workflow> - - <workflow> - <stage>continue</stage> <mode>installation</mode> <defaults> <enable_back>yes</enable_back> @@ -1595,7 +1408,6 @@ </modules> </workflow> - <workflow> <defaults> <archs>all</archs> @@ -1632,5 +1444,72 @@ </modules> </workflow> + <!-- dummy, but needed to trigger 2nd stage --> + <workflow> + <defaults> + <archs>all</archs> + <enable_back>no</enable_back> + <enable_next>no</enable_next> + </defaults> + <stage>continue</stage> + <mode>autoupgrade</mode> + <modules config:type="list"> + <module> + <label>Perform Update</label> + <name>autopost</name> + </module> + <module> + <label>Perform Update</label> + <name>rpmcopy_secondstage</name> + </module> + <module> + <heading>yes</heading> + <label>Configuration</label> + </module> + <module> + <label>System Configuration</label> + <name>autoconfigure</name> + </module> + <module> + <label>Clean Up</label> + <name>suseconfig</name> + </module> + </modules> + </workflow> + + <!-- is for AutoUpdate, special mode does not exist - for SP1, so that 2nd stage YaST needn't be modified --> + <workflow> + <defaults> + <archs>all</archs> + <enable_back>no</enable_back> + <enable_next>no</enable_next> + </defaults> + <stage>continue</stage> + <mode>update</mode> + <modules config:type="list"> + <module> + <label>Perform Update</label> + <name>autopost</name> + </module> + <module> + <label>Perform Update</label> + <name>rpmcopy_secondstage</name> + </module> + <module> + <heading>yes</heading> + <label>Configuration</label> + </module> + <module> + <label>System Configuration</label> + <name>autoconfigure</name> + </module> + <module> + <label>Clean Up</label> + <name>suseconfig</name> + </module> + </modules> + </workflow> + + </workflows> </productDefines> -- To unsubscribe, e-mail: yast-commit+unsubscribe@opensuse.org For additional commands, e-mail: yast-commit+help@opensuse.org